Assessing climate change impacts and agronomic adaptation strategies for dryland crop production in southern Africa

Dryland farmers in southern Africa operate under harsh conditions; infertile soils, erratic rainfall regimes, sub-optimal input levels etc. Crop yields have generally been low, negatively affecting food security and livelihoods.
